Abstract The invention discloses a proxy re-encryption method supporting complex access control element description. The proxy re-encryption method comprises the following steps: establishing a system; creating data; obtaining access control elements; generating a proxy re-encryption key parameter; generating ciphertext data after description; acquiring ciphertext data; and the user decrypting the re-encrypted ciphertext.
